TREE STUMP REMOVAL AND CONCRETE PAVEMENT REPAIR
FACILITIES MANAGEMENT DIVISION
CALNET - BUILDING 057
SACRAMENTO, SACRAMENTO COUNTY, CALIFORNIA
CONTRACT NUMBER: 25-300703, PROJECT NUMBER: 100057

This project is being bid in accordance with Government Code 14838.7 and is open only to Small Business and Micro Business contractors certified through the California Department of General Services, Office of Small Business and DVBE Services.

Bids shall be submitted electronically to Eric.Waddell@dgs.ca.gov before 2:00 P.M, September 14, 2026.

Project comprises labor, material and services necessary for: Tree stump removal and concrete pavement repair.

License required to bid the project: A

Certificate of Reported Compliance (CRC) - Fleet Vehicles: As a condition of Contract award, prior to Contract execution, Contractor shall submit copies of the valid CRCs for any fleet retained by the Contractor or any listed Subcontractor, for which any vehicles subject to the California Air Resources Board In-Use Off-Road Diesel Fueled Fleet Regulations, Section 2449(i), Title 12, California Code of Regulations, are used in the completion of the work included in the Contract.
More information on the In-Use Off-Road Diesel-Fueled Fleets Regulation can be found at the following link: https://ww2.arb.ca.gov/our-work/programs/use-road-diesel-fueled-fleets-regulation

Health and Safety Provisions: Contractor and all subcontractors shall abide by all health and safety mandates issued by federal, state, and local governments and/or public health officers as well as those issued by DGS, and worksite specific mandates. If multiple mandates exist, the Contractor and subcontractors shall abide by the most restrictive mandate. The term -employee-, -worker-, -state worker- or -state employee- in health and safety mandates includes contractor and subcontractor personnel.

Costs associated with adhering to health and safety mandates are the responsibility of the Contractor. Contractor is responsible for the tracking and compliance of health and safety mandates and may be audited upon request.

Successful bidder shall furnish payment and performance bonds, each in the amount of 100 percent of the Contract price.

Prospective bidders must attend the mandatory prebid site inspection tour on August 18, 2026 at 10:00 A.M., at CalNet building, 1530 12th Street/ 1115 P Street Sacramento, CA 95814. Attendance for the entire inspection is required in order for bidders to be eligible to submit a bid.

States estimated cost: $8,200.00. The term of this project is 365 calendar days.
